Cracked Foundation Repair in Union County, NJ
Cracked foundation repair services address issues where the structural base of a property has developed cracks or other damage that can compromise stability. These services typically cover a range of projects, including repairing existing cracks, stabilizing shifting foundations, and preventing further deterioration caused by soil movement or moisture problems. Property owners often want to understand the signs of foundation damage, such as visible cracks, uneven floors, or doors and windows that no longer close properly, to determine when repairs might be necessary.
Before requesting foundation repair, homeowners should consider the extent and location of the damage, as well as any underlying causes like soil settlement or water intrusion. It’s important to evaluate whether cracks are active or stable, and to understand the potential impacts on the overall safety and value of the property. Clear communication about the specific issues observed and the history of any previous repairs can help in planning effective solutions for foundation stabilization and long-term durability.

Common Cracked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ation crack repair - addresses visible cracks to prevent further structural issues.
Uneven floor leveling - stabilizes floors that have shifted due to foundation settling.
Basement wall reinforcement - stabilizes and supports basement walls affected by shifting or cracking.
Pier and beam stabilization - corrects settling issues in homes with pier and beam foundations.
Slope correction and grading - manages soil and drainage to reduce foundation movement risks.
Waterproofing and drainage solutions - helps protect foundations from water damage and soil erosion.
Cracked Foundation Repair Questions
What are signs of a cracked foundation? Common ind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ly.
How does foundation cracking affect a property? Cracks can lead to structural instability, water intrusion, and increased repair costs if not addressed promptly.
What causes foundation cracks? Factors such as soil movement, moisture changes, and poor construction practices can contribute to foundation cracking.
When should property owners consider repair services? Repairs are recommended when cracks are wide, growing, or accompanied by other signs of foundation movement or damage.
